Abstract
In the digitization era, the change of urban spatial environment is more rapid, so the limitations of traditional theory and method of urban planning is gradually exposing. It cannot solve the complex social problems because it limited by its major. Also, it is constrained by the qualitative analysis, lacking of the accumulation of basic data, quantitative scientific demonstration, virtual expression and the integral manner, more shortage of tools that carry out synthetic analysis using these data. What´s more, as the social development, the interactive work between planning department or between planning department and the public is more important. But we can combine these services together such as, service of trust, authority,document turning and information sharing to form a safe workflow business system through using workflow, so it can provides realizable technology method for different operation system. Therefore, developing the study of urban planning system framework based on workflow can help simplify the flow of work, reduce the cost of software development, and improve work efficiency.
